LX7178 is 5A Constant Frequency Hysteretic Synchronous Buck Regulator manufactured by Microsemi.

The LX7178 is a digitally controlled step-down regulator IC with an integrated 40mΩ high-side P-channel MOSFET and a 14mΩ low-side N-channel MOSFET. It Features
Microsemi’s proprietary constant-frequency hysteretic control engine for near-instantaneous correction to line/load transients. It does not require high-ESR output capacitors and incorporates energysaving “PSM” (Power Save or Pulse Skip Mode) at light loads, to extend battery life in mobile applications.
The LX7178 has an I2C serial interface port for output voltage margining and monitoring if required (it can also operate in default mode). In addition it includes robust fault monitoring functions.
The LX7178 will operate from 3V to 5.5V, and is available in 0.8V fixed output voltage option (no voltage divider is necessary). The output voltage can also be adjusted with an external voltage divider up to 3.3V.
Constant Frequency Hysteretic Control Extremely Fast Line/Load Transient Response I2C for Output Adjustment (3.4Mbps) 1.875 MHz Switching Frequency Extremely Low-RDSON MOSFETS Input Voltage Rail 3.3V to 5V Greater than 5A Output Current I2C Selectable Power Save Mode for Light-Load
Efficiency UVLO, OVP, OCP 0°C to +85°C Ambient Temperature Available in WLCSP-20 (0.4mm pitch) Ro HS pliant
